The online program will focus on the meaningful and inspiring life of Harriet Tubman, who was an American abolitionist and political activist; the program will also display most of the Underground Railroads associated with her in Maryland. Tubman was born into slavery, escaped, and heroically saved many people, including friends and family with her network of antislavery activists and safe house known as the Underground Railroads.
